The anatomy of a «system» of power

They are called fictions. According to Wikipedia it is called «the classification of any story that originates in fiction and thus is not based on history or fact. Η fiction can be expressed in a variety of media, including writing, television programmes, films.» Fiction is therefore also a series we watched on NETFIX, «Anatomy of a Scandal» with the excellent Sienna Mieller. I repeat that it comes from the imagination...

There, a group of rich kids (nicknamed «prodigals»), classmates at a school of similar «stature», climb to power with the British conservatives, the «Tories». In the main protagonists, one is prime minister, the other is a minister. They are linked by a secret that could ruin the careers of both (we don't give details, we don't «spoil», as they say, so watch the show). So they support each other.

According to the fiction (because that doesn't really happen...), they've been trained to lie since they were children. They learned it from their parents and it was a normal thing. Of course, they are also highly competent, being educated in the best schools. They also have an ingrained belief: They believe that no one says «no» to them! Even when the minister is accused by his co-worker (and former mistress) of raping her, he denies it by claiming it was «consensual». At first you think the minister can't lie, too. He believes it himself that his ex-lover didn't say «no» to him, but even if she did, she meant «yes»! Besides, Whitehouse (that's the minister's last name) always wins, they learn that from a young age, they teach that to their children... Men are «macho» (but in a sophisticated way), women are vulnerable...

At the trial the minister is unanimously acquitted (this is not fictional, because ministers are rarely tried). But there is the divine trial and eventually the guilty secret is revealed (again, I'm not revealing it for you to see).

This fiction (which has nothing to do with reality, I repeat) refers to the anatomy of a scandal, but in reality it is a dissection of a system of power that reproduces and protects each other.

In Great Britain this series was the subject of controversy because some «saw» in it the intention to morally damage the Tory government with Boris Johnson as Prime Minister. We don't believe this, because stories about children from good families, who attend good schools and climb to office by supporting each other, simply belong to the realm of fantasy, fiction, and have nothing to do with reality...
